Mix competion: 15 songs are selected by (jury? staff?)
Participants register (here on the forum) and get a link to a .rar with 320k -mp3s of the 15 songs
The 15 songs needs to be cleared by the owners (labels) first obviously, something i dont think should be a problem (this being DSF and all...) And if say, only tunes older than +6months are chosen (as example, BlackBox could approve the use of Killawatt & Thelem's "kaba" (released july 2012)
THE COMPETITION: Since everyone is using the same songs, will be interesting as the result will differ alot DJ from DJ. Points can be given for
- Track order
- Mixing
- Creativity
- Sound quality
- "Flow" / Conceptual whole
(As example, one DJ might mix live with vinyls, and get that "live" mixing feel with analogue feel and control of the faders/eq/FX whilst another one uses Ableton and get a more streamlined/focused mix but which sacrifices some of that "live" feel...Yet a third dude might use both type of techniques) all can be equally pleasing to listen to, but in very different ways.
The challenge for the DJs is to create a unique and cool mix using the same data (songs) as everyone else
The reward Im sure they would learn alot from each other while doing so, possibly drawing inspiration from the other mixes etc.....
The prize whatever fun thing you can come up with (apart from eternal glory and internetz fame)
